MU Uggglllyy numbers.... & MU DID NOT BEAT ESTIMATES

MU lost .04 per share. The $.01 loss being mentioned is from the "continuing operations" which relates to the MUEI spinoff of the PC biz, etc. When the analysts made their estimates, this was not counted in. As such, MU pulled a gimmick out of their @SS & the press is comparing wrong numbers to analysts estimates.

Overall:
On the market side (horrible):

-Consolidated net sales of $1,066 million v. 1,572 million last year
-Inventories up 14%, up 66% from Aug. 31
-Net sales decreased 33% sequentially
~50% decrease in average selling prices for memory products
~Gross margins on these chips 18% v. 49% sequentially

Execution side (not looking good)
-COGS 865.4 v. 681.1 (2000)
-SG&A 130.9 v. 103.3 (2000)

The BONUS: Interest Income this Q was 39.6 v. 2000 expense of 2.7
